Fathers Club
Originally known as the "St. Louis U. High Club," the Fathers Club began in 1938 to support school activities. The organization played a large role in construction of the basement recreation room and the first major addition to the school plant. It also helped bring about parking lots, locker room renovation and the library. Today, the Fathers Club offers a number of opportunities for fathers and father-figures of current students to partner with SLUH in the development of their sons.
